Luxury crossover SUVs continue to gain traction among consumers, eclipsing traditional sedans in popularity. As drivers lean towards vehicles that blend comfort and practicality, the appeal of these crossovers remains strong for 2025. According to data from iSeeCars, these vehicles successfully combine the ride quality of a sedan with the commanding presence of an SUV.
Crossover SUVs are designed on a car platform, allowing for a smoother ride and better handling compared to truck-based SUVs. Typically equipped with smaller, more fuel-efficient engines, such as turbocharged four-cylinders or small V6s, these vehicles offer enhanced fuel economy. While they excel in daily driving conditions, they do not possess the off-roading capabilities of traditional SUVs.
The range of luxury crossover SUVs available is impressive, from compact models to spacious three-row options. Each model aims to cater to varying passenger and cargo needs while offering features such as all-wheel drive, advanced safety systems, and modern technology. As a result, crossovers remain a preferred choice for those seeking versatility in a single vehicle.
Leading Luxury Crossover SUVs for 2025
The best luxury crossover SUVs for 2025 offer a combination of impressive ride quality, advanced safety features, and the latest technology. Notably, many of these vehicles come with a comprehensive suite of active safety systems designed to enhance driver confidence and passenger security.
For those looking to indulge in enhanced luxury, higher trims often include premium amenities, such as cabin air fragrance systems and refrigerated center consoles. The following models stand out for their reliability, value retention, and cargo capacity:
1. **Acura MDX**
– iSeeCars Score: 8.5 / 10
– Reliability: 8.0 / 10
– Value Retention: 7.6 / 10
– Safety: 10 / 10
– MSRP: $51,800 – $75,850
– Used Price: $26,086 – $58,990
– MPG: 19 – 22
– Cargo Volume: 16.3 cu ft
2. **Mercedes-Benz GLE**
– iSeeCars Score: 8.5 / 10
– Reliability: 7.7 / 10
– Value Retention: 7.8 / 10
– Safety: 10 / 10
– MSRP: $61,850 – $132,150
– Used Price: $31,388 – $85,996
– MPG: 16 – 23
– Cargo Volume: 33.3 cu ft
3. **Lexus RX 350**
– iSeeCars Score: 8.4 / 10
– Reliability: 8.4 / 10
– Value Retention: 8.5 / 10
– Safety: 8.4 / 10
– MSRP: $48,975 – $61,370
– Used Price: $33,490 – $58,900
– MPG: 24 – 25
– Cargo Volume: 29.6 cu ft
4. **BMW X3**
– iSeeCars Score: 8.4 / 10
– Reliability: 7.7 / 10
– Value Retention: 7.5 / 10
– Safety: 9.9 / 10
– MSRP: $50,900 – $65,900
– Used Price: $24,455 – $54,655
– MPG: 27 – 29
– Cargo Volume: 31.5 cu ft
5. **Volvo XC60**
– iSeeCars Score: 8.3 / 10
– Reliability: 8.3 / 10
– Value Retention: 7.6 / 10
– Safety: 9.0 / 10
– MSRP: $47,050 – $58,100
– Used Price: $24,990 – $51,679
– MPG: 26
– Cargo Volume: 22.4 cu ft
6. **INFINITI QX60**
– iSeeCars Score: 8.3 / 10
– Reliability: 7.9 / 10
– Value Retention: 7.1 / 10
– Safety: 10 / 10
– MSRP: $50,200 – $66,150
– Used Price: $19,500 – $58,651
– MPG: 24
– Cargo Volume: 14.5 cu ft
7. **Porsche Cayenne**
– iSeeCars Score: 8.0 / 10
– Reliability: 8.2 / 10
– Value Retention: 7.8 / 10
– Safety: Not Available
– MSRP: $68,800 – $135,300
– Used Price: $41,300 – $98,900
– MPG: 18 – 22
– Cargo Volume: 27.2 – 27.5 cu ft
These luxury crossover SUVs combine reliability, safety, and high cargo space, appealing to a wide range of consumers. The **Acura MDX**, **Mercedes-Benz GLE**, and **Lexus RX 350** lead the pack with superior overall scores. Meanwhile, models like the **BMW X3** and **Volvo XC60** balance performance and fuel efficiency for practical everyday use.
